Biggest box ship to call in Virginia docks at Norfolk

Feb 24, 2010 Port

THE biggest containership to call at Virginia Ports, the 8,402-TEU MSC Tomoko, docked at Norfolk International Terminals to load and discharge cargo recently.

The MSC Tomoko, drawing 46 feet of water, just cleared the Hampton Roads 50-foot shipping channel. Aircraft carriers, which make Norfolk their home, draw 40 feet, reported the Newport News Daily Press.

The MSC Tomoko was scheduled to call at New York part of a revised route dubbed the Golden Gate Service, which follows the rotation of New York, Baltimore, Norfolk, Freeport, Bahamas; Suez, Jeddah, Colombo, Singapore; Shenzhen-Chiwan, Hong Kong, Shanghai; Ningbo, Shenzhen-Chiwan as well as Singapore and Salalah in Oman.
